Re: Does ablation help with bleeding anemia Adenomyosis?

I didn't bother with the ablation. My doctor mentioned it as an alternative, but also said because my uterus was so misshapen (boggy), he did not feel he would be able to reach all the adenomyosis. Also, he said -like others have explained here -- that it will not remove any glands that have grown deep into the tissue, and there's no way to tell where those are. He felt that it was not a good solution for me, and we went with the LAVH. I have not regretted it for a SECOND, and it's been six months. It has been such a relief and JOY to be finally free of the bleeding and pain. I'm so glad I didn't waste a second on the ablation but went straight to the hysterectomy. Best decision I could have made.

The pathology report came back "extensive adenomyosis", so my doc was right on the money. The ablation would NOT have helped long term and I would have ended up with the hysto anyway.

Re: Does ablation help with bleeding anemia Adenomyosis?

This is long past the original question, but...In my case, the ablation absolutely helped. I was able to "buy" about a year and not jump off a tall building. It was miraculous for me and simple. After having my daughter (now almost 4), I was having the periods of a teenager and pain that I could hardly stand for weeks on end each and every month. I could hardly leave the house when I was on my periods due to the extremely heavy bleeding. The adenomyosis had been diagnosed, but I wasn't ready to have a hysterectomy, so my doctor offered an ablation. I had wonderful results and would highly recommend it. I have just now had the hysterecomy on June 9, 2009. I am currently 5 1/2 wks post-op and this is NO picnic. With adenomyosis, the hysterectomy is almost eminent, so waiting only makes the adenomyosis worsen, it seems, as was the case with me. I suffered for many, many months with horrible cramping and wish I had just gone ahead and done this a year or more ago. Mine was the worse case my seasoned surgeon had ever seen and the recovery has not been easy. (thus an email at 3:30am from Florida) Ablation is definitely only a temporary fix, which we all knew, but definitely a good fix. If you are trying to buy some time, then have it - it's easy and works. The hysterectomy is far more major than I ever dreamed and the recovery SUCKS, but so has all the suffering due to adenomyosis leading up to this. I hope this helps someone out there.
